We report frequency locking of a 1083-nm DBR diode laser on a high-finesse Fabry-Perot cavity (F similar or equal to 2800). We used the Pound-Drever FM locking scheme at a modulation rate of 5 MHz. A lock bandwidth of about 1 MHz is obtained by using a three-path servo loop. The laser linewidth is narrowed to similar to 5 kHz. The root Allan variance sigma(tau) of the laser frequency with respect to the cavity reaches a minimum of 4 +/- 1 Hz at tau = 10 s.
